I have visited San Pedro and Caye Caulker 4 times in 5 years now and found these wonderful islands via this forum. Today I happened to stumble upon a brand new (opened today) Middle-Eastern cuisine place that was IMHO worth opening a membership to mention. I had some of the best Hummus, Stuffed Grape Leaves and Kibbeh this side of Beirut. It's located right on the Front? street, corner before the Split. The girl was sweet, the food was great, American fare served as well. Definitely worth checking out if you're on Caye Caulker, I'll be going back.

Just curious, why would someone want MiddleEastern Food in the Carribean ? Clean, light, tasty and made from locally available ingredients. Further, it represents the cuisine of a portion of the local population. The cuisine question that comes up for me much more often is why there are so many Italian restaurants - pasta and cheese in the tropics is way harsher on the system than a lovely roasted chicken or a nice plate of hummus.
